Response Inhibition
The mental process involved in suppressing actions that are inappropriate or no longer required.
Attention-Demanding Tasks
Activities that require a high level of focus and mental effort to accomplish.
Older Adults
Individuals typically aged 65 years and over, often characterized by increased life experience and, potentially, age-related health concerns.
Parkinson's Disease
A neurodegenerative disorder characterized by tremors, stiffness, and difficulty with balance and coordination, caused by a loss of dopamine-producing brain cells.
